@charset "utf-8";
/* CSS Document */

/* 手机端在PC端隐藏 */

@media only screen and (min-width:900px) {
    #gnav {display: none;}
    #openmenu {display: none;}
    
}

@media only screen and (max-width:1500px) {
/* 全部公共 */
	/* 上导航 */
	.navbar li {margin: 0 1vw;}
	/* 上导航 */
/* 全部公共 */

/* 首页 */
	/* 关于我们 */
	.sec2-cont {width: 90vw;}
	/* 关于我们 */
/* 首页 */

}



@media only screen and (max-width:1200px) {

/* 上导航 */
.navbar li a {font-size: 14px;}
.barwrap {padding: 0 20px;}
.barwrap .zoom {margin-left: 20px;}
.barwrap .div2 b {width: max-content;font-size: 16px;}
.barwrap .logo img {width: auto;}
.navbar {padding-right: 10px;}
/* 上导航 */


/* 工艺流程 */
#liucout .box .miaoshu p {font-size: 14px;}
/* 工艺流程 */

/* 联系我们 */
.sec6-cont>ul {width: 90vw;}
.sec6-cont .p2 {font-size: 16px;}
.sec6-cont li:last-child .p2 {font-size: 16px;}
.sec6-cont li div {padding-left: 10px;width: 70%;}
.sec6-cont ul li>span {width: 50px;height: 50px;}

/* 联系我们 */

}



@media only screen and (max-width:900px) {


/* -------------全部页面公共样式------------- */

.w1200 {width: 100%;}

/* 上导航 */
.navbar {display: none;}
.barwrap {height: 18vw;width: 100%;}
.barwrap.on #openmenu span {background-color: #333;}
#openmenu {display: block;
    width: 10vw;
    height: 10vw;
    text-indent: -99em;
    overflow: hidden;transition: all .5s ease;
    z-index: 200;
    cursor: pointer;position: relative;}

	#openmenu span {
		display: block;
		width: 8vw;
		height: 2px;
		background-color: #fff;
        position: absolute;
		left: 0px;
		transition: all .25s ease;}
		#openmenu span:nth-child(1) {top: 3vw;left: 1vw;}
		#openmenu span:nth-child(2) {top: 5vw;left: 1vw;}
		#openmenu span:nth-child(3) {top: 7vw;left: 1vw;}
		#openmenu.is-open span:nth-child(1) {transform: rotate(45deg);top: 5vw;
}
		#openmenu.is-open span:nth-child(2) {opacity: 0;
}
		#openmenu.is-open span:nth-child(3) {
			transform: rotate(-45deg);top: 5vw}

	.bodyfixed{
		position: fixed;
		width: 100%;
		height: 100%;
	}
 

	.gnav{
		background:#39a783;
		padding-bottom: 30px;
		overflow:auto;
		z-index:150;
/*		position: fixed;*/
		right: auto;
		left:0px;
		top:0px;
		width:100%;
		height: 100%;
		transform:translate3d(0,0,2px);
		display: none;
        position: fixed;
	}
	#openmenu.is-open {
		-webkit-transform: translate3d(0,0,3px) rotate(360deg);
		transform: translate3d(0,0,3px) rotate(360deg);}


	.gnav-list-item{
		display: block;
		margin: 0;
		transition: all 1.75s ease;
		opacity: 0;
		transform: translate(0,20px);
		margin-bottom: 4vw;
	}

	.is-active .gnav-list-item:nth-child(1) {transition-delay:0.2s;}
	.is-active .gnav-list-item:nth-child(2) {transition-delay:0.5s;}
	.is-active .gnav-list-item:nth-child(3) {transition-delay:0.8s;}
	.is-active .gnav-list-item:nth-child(4) {transition-delay:1.1s;}
	.is-active .gnav-list-item:nth-child(5) {transition-delay:1.4s;}
	.is-active .gnav-list-item:nth-child(6) {transition-delay:1.7s;}
	.is-active .gnav-list-item:nth-child(7) {transition-delay:2s;}

	.is-active .gnav-list-item{
		opacity: 1;
		transform: translate(0,0px);
	}
    .barwrap {padding: 0 4vw;}
    .barwrap .zoom {margin-left: 0;margin: 0 4vw;}
    .barwrap .zoom img {width: 6vw;}
    .barwrap .div2 b {font-size: 3vw;}
    .barwrap .div2 strong {font-size: 4vw;}

   
    #gnav .gnav-logo img {width: 50vw;margin: 20vw auto 10vw auto;}
	.gnav-list {display: flex;flex-direction: column;align-items: center;}
	.gnav-list a {background-color: #f9b032;width: 40vw;height: 10vw;display: flex;align-items: center;justify-content: center;border-radius:5vw}
	.gnav-list a span {color: #fff;}

	
/* 上导航 */


/* -------------全部页面公共样式------------- */

/* ------------首页------------- */


/* 首页公共 */
.inx-title .title {font-size: 7vw;}

/* 首页公共 */

/* banner */
/*.banner {height: 60vw!important;}*/

.banner .bannerfix>li .bimg {height:80vw;object-fit:cover}

/* banner */

/* 关于我们 */
.sec2-cont {width: 90%;margin-top: 0;padding: 8vw 4vw;}
.index-sec2 {padding: 8vw 0;background: none;}
.sec2-cont ul {flex-wrap: wrap;justify-content: space-between;padding: 6vw 0;}
.sec2-cont li {display: flex;flex-direction: column;align-items: center;margin-bottom: 6vw;}
.sec2-cont li:nth-child(2n+1) {width: 49%;}
.sec2-cont li:nth-child(2n) {display: none;}
.sec2-cont .p1 {font-size: 3.4vw;line-height: 2em;}
.sec2-cont h3 {font-size: 8vw;}
/* 关于我们 */


/* 产品中心 */

.sec3-cont h3 {font-size: 5vw;padding-bottom: 0;}
.index-sec3 #swiper1 {padding-top: 0;}
.sec3-cont .cp-tu {justify-content: flex-start;align-items: flex-start;opacity: 1;}
.sec3-cont .cp-text {padding-top: 0vw;margin-top: 50vw;}
.sec3-cont .jianjie {
    margin-bottom: 3vw;
    /*height:50vw;*/
}
.sec3-cont .more {margin: 7vw auto;}
.sec3-cont .cp-tu img {height: 40vw;object-fit: contain;}
.sec3-cont .swiper-slide:hover .cp-text {transform: unset;margin-top: 50vw;}
.index-sec3>div {background: rgba(0,0,0,.7);}
/* 产品中心 */


/* 工艺流程 */
.inx-liucheng {padding-top: 0;}
#liucout .box .tu {width: 30vw;height: 30vw;}
#liucout li:nth-child(2n+1) .box .tu {margin-top:8vw}
#liucout li:nth-child(2n) .box .tu {margin-bottom:8vw}
#liucout .box .miaoshu {height: 38vw;border-radius: 2vw;}
#liucout .box .miaoshu {padding: 3vw;}
.inx-liucheng .cout {padding-bottom: 20vw;}
#liucout .box .name {margin-top: 0;margin-bottom: 1vw;font-size: 4vw;}
#liucout .box .miaoshu p {font-size: 3vw;}
/* 工艺流程 */

/* 童圣优势 */

.xilie {display: none;}
.xilie-ph {display:block;width: 100%;height: 80vw;position: relative;overflow: hidden;}
.xilie-ph .bgimg {position: relative;width: 100%;height: 100%;overflow: hidden;}
.xilie-ph .bgimg li {width: 100%;height: 100%;transition: all 1000ms ease 0ms;}
.xilie-ph .bgimg .img {width: 100%;height: 100%;background-size: cover;background-position: center;}
.xilie-ph .bgimg .mask {width: 100%;height: 100%;}
.xilie-ph .xiliebox-ph {position: absolute;top: 0;width: 100%;height: 100%;display: flex;}

.xilie-ph .xiliebox-ph>li {height: 100%;transition: all .5s;cursor: pointer;;transition-timing-function:cubic-bezier(0.68, -0.55, 0.265, 1.55);background-color: rgba(0,0,0,.5);}


.xilie-ph .xiliebox-ph .on {background-color: rgba(0,0,0,.5);}
.xiliebox-ph * {color: #fff;}
.xiliebox-ph li h1 {font-size: 6vw;font-weight: bold;color: #fff;margin-bottom: 20px;}
.xiliebox-ph li>div {width: 80%;display: flex;flex-direction: column;align-items: center;height: 80%;}

.xiliebox-ph>li {display: flex;flex-direction: column;align-items: center;justify-content: center;}


.xiliebox-ph .xlcout {opacity: 1;height: unset;}
.xilie-list-ph {margin-top: 20px;width: 100%;}
.xilie-list-ph li {border-bottom: 1px dashed rgba(255,255,255,.6);padding: 10px 0;}
.xiliebox-ph li ul a {display: flex;align-items: center;justify-content: space-between;transition: all .3s ease;padding: 4px 0;}
.xiliebox-ph li ul a img {width: 14px;}

.xiliebox-ph li>div>div {display: flex;flex-direction: column;align-items: center;width: 100%;}
#xiliebg-ph {width: 100%;height: 100%;}
#xiliecout-ph {position: absolute;top: 0;left: 0;width: 100%;height: 100%;}

#xiliecout-ph  .swiper-pagination-bullet {background-color: #fff;width: 6vw;height: 1vw;border-radius: unset;opacity: .5;}
#xiliecout-ph .swiper-pagination-bullet-active {opacity: 1;}
#xiliecout-ph .swiper-pagination {bottom: 2vw;
    left: 50%;
    transform: translateX(-50%);}
/* 童圣优势 */

/* 为什么选择 */
.whychse .bijiao {width: 90%;}
.whychse {padding-top: 0;}
.whychse .bijiao>div {font-size: 4vw;padding: 0 10vw;}
.whychse .whycout img {height: 24vw;}
.whychse .whycout {margin-top: 10vw;display: flex;flex-wrap: wrap;}
.whychse .whycout li {width: 50%;flex: unset;}
.whychse .whycout li .box span {height: 20vw;
    display: flex;
    font-size: 3.4vw;
    line-height: 2em;}
    .whychse {padding-bottom: 10vw;}
/* 为什么选择 */


/* 合作案例 */
.inx-case {padding: 10vw 0;}
#swiper2 {padding-top: 10vw;}
.index-sec4 .swiper-button-prev {right: 60%;}
.index-sec4 .swiper-button-next {right: 0;left: 60%;}
.index-sec4 .line {display: none;}
.index-sec4 .swiper-button-next:hover, .index-sec4 .swiper-button-prev:hover {background-color: #fff;color:#e09e21;}
.index-sec4 figure, .index-sec4 figure img {height:60vw}
.index-sec4 a p {font-size: 3.4vw;line-height: 2em;padding: 3vw;height: 20vw;}

/* 新闻中心 */
.index-sec5>div {background-color: #00000000;} 

.index-sec5 {padding: 1vw 0 10vw 0;;background-position: center;background-size: cover;background-image: url(../img/bg7.jpg);}
.index-sec5 li:nth-child(2n) {margin: unset;}
.index-sec5 li {width: 76%;transform: translateX(6vw);margin:unset;margin-bottom: 6vw!important;}


.index-sec5 ul {flex-direction: column;align-items: center;}
.index-sec5 .time {width: 18vw;height: 18vw;transform: translateY(-50%);margin: 0;}
.index-sec5 b {font-size: 5vw;}
.index-sec5 strong {font-size: 4vw;}
.index-sec5 figcaption {padding: 4vw 4vw 4vw 10vw;}
.index-sec5 p {margin-right: 0;width: 100%;font-size: 3.4vw;}
.index-sec5 li h3 {margin-right: 0;
    width: 100%;
    margin-bottom: 2vw;
    font-size: 4.4vw;
    font-weight: bold;
    color: #333;}

/* 新闻中心 */

/* 联系我们 */
.sec6-cont {padding-top: 20vw;}
.sec6-cont>ul {width: 90%;flex-direction: column;height: unset;margin: 10vw 0;}
.inxfootnav ul {flex-wrap: wrap;}
.sec6-cont>ul li:nth-child(2n) {display: none;}
.sec6-cont>ul li:nth-child(2n+1) {width: 100%;justify-content: flex-start;padding: 4vw 6vw;border-bottom: 1px solid #e09e21;}
.sec6-cont>ul li:nth-child(2n+1):last-child {border-bottom: unset;}   
.sec6-cont li:last-child .p2 {font-size: 3.4vw;}
.sec6-cont .p2 {font-size: 3.4vw;}
.sec6-cont .copyright {position: unset;font-size: 3.4vw;}
.inxfootnav ul li {width: 33.3333%;margin: 0;margin-bottom: 4vw;}
.inxfootnav ul a {font-size: 4vw;}

    
/* 联系我们 */



/* ------------首页------------- */





/* ------------二级页面------------- */

/* 全部公共 */
.pbanner {height: 70vw;}
.pbanner .text {width: 100%;}
/* 全部公共 */

/* 页底 */
.footer .foot {padding: 0 8vw;padding-top: 8vw;}
.footer .foot .ndao {display: flex;flex-direction: column;padding-bottom: 3vw;}
.footer .foot .ndao .ljie {border: 1px dashed rgba(255,255,255,.5);}
.footer .foot .ndao .ljie {margin-bottom: 4vw;}
.footer .foot .ndao .ljie a {width: 33.3333%;padding: unset;text-align: center;margin: 2vw 0;}
.footer .lian {margin-top: 4vw;}
.footer .foot .taile {display: flex;flex-direction: column;align-items: center;padding-top: 4vw;}
.footer .foot .taile .sdha {width: 100%;}
.footer .foot .taile .sdha em {width: 100%;display: flex;}
.footer .foot .taile .ewma strong {padding: unset;}
.footer .foot .taile .ewma {margin-top: 6vw;}
.footer .weibu {display: flex;flex-direction: column;margin-top: 4vw;}
.footer .weibu * {color: #696969}
.footer .weibu .inner {margin-bottom: 0;}
/* 页底 */


/* 全部公共 */

/* 关于我们 */
.about-honey .swiper-slide>a {width: 90%;margin: 0 auto;height: 60vw;padding: 4vw;}
.about-honey #swiper_zs {height: 76vw;}
.about-honey .swiper-slide>a>div {height: 44vw;}

/* 关于我们 */

/* 产品中心 */
.towproduct {flex-direction: column;}
.towproduct .box {width: 100%;margin: 0;margin-bottom: 8vw;}
.towproduct .box .cout {height: 52vw;box-shadow: 8px 8px 15px rgba(0, 0, 0, 0.1), -8px -8px 15px rgba(255, 255, 255, 1);}
.towproduct .box p {margin-top: 4vw;}
.productpage {padding-bottom: 8vw;}
/* 产品中心 */


/* 合作案例 */
.casepage li {width: 100%;}
.casepage li img {border-radius: 4vw;}
/* 合作案例 */


/* 新闻中心 */
.listnav a {width: 26vw;}
.newsList {display: flex;flex-direction: column;align-items: center;}
.newsList {margin-left: 0;}
.newsList li {margin-left: 0;width: 80vw;}
.newsList .bodr {height: 80vw;}
.newsList .txts {padding: 6vw;}
.newsList .txts .sy {padding: 0;}
.newsList .txts .nowti {height: unset;}
.newsList .txts .date {left: 6vw;
    bottom: 4vw;}
/* 新闻中心 */

/* 联系我们 */
.contactpage {padding: 0;}
.contactpage .ul1 {display: flex;flex-wrap: wrap;}
.contactpage .ul1 li {flex: unset;width: 50%;}
.contactpage .w1200 {padding: 6vw;}
.contactpage .div1 {display: flex;flex-direction: column;width: 100%;}
.contactpage .in {width: 100%;margin-top: 4vw;}
.contactpage .area {width: 100%;}
.contactpage .div1 {padding-top: 4vw;}
.contactpage .sub {width: 100%;margin-bottom: 4vw;}
.contactpage .btn-div1 {display: flex;flex-direction: column-reverse;}
/* 联系我们 */


/* ------------二级页面------------- */


.index-sec6 {
    width: 100%;
    height: 100%;
    background: url(../img/bg6.jpg) no-repeat;
    background-size: cover;
}
.ewmbox {
    padding: 30px 0;
}


}

/*2022.02.09新增*/
@media only screen and (max-width:1500px) {
    #liucout .box .miaoshu p {
        font-size: 14px;
        line-height: 1.6em;
    }
    .xilie .inx-title {
        top: 100px;
    }
    .sec3-cont .jianjie {
        width: 80%;
        white-space: normal;
        overflow: hidden;
        word-wrap: break-word;
        text-overflow: ellipsis;
        display: -webkit-box;
        -webkit-line-clamp: 3;/* 文本行数 */
        -webkit-box-orient: vertical;
    }
    .sec3-cont .more {
        margin: 40px auto;
    }
    .inx-title {
        margin: 30px 0;
        display: flex;
        flex-direction: column;
        align-items: center;
    }
    .sec6-cont>ul {
        margin: 30px auto;
    }
    .ewmbox .img img {
        width: 90px;
    }
    .sec6-cont {
        padding-top: 50px;
    }
    .sec6-cont h2 {
        font-size: 40px;
    }
    
    
    
    
    
}

.xilie-ph{
    display: none;
}
@media only screen and (max-width: 900px){
    #liucout .box .miaoshu p {
        height: 27.5vw;
        overflow-y: scroll;
    }
    
}
